Between October 2nd and October 6th your student will be participating in a Student Engagement Survey. This survey was written by the district and takes less than 10 minutes to complete. It asks students to respond to questions in areas related to environment, learning, and relationships. Information from this survey is used by teachers and administrators to identify areas of improvement related to the student experience.

FHS ATHLETIC EVENTS REMINDER FOR YOUNGER FANS
As a reminder for our high school athletic events, students from the elementary and middle school attending any FHS athletic events must be accompanied by a parent/guardian/caregiver. Students that come to the event without an accompanying parent/guardian/caregiver will not be admitted to the event. Students who need redirection regarding their behavior at any FHS athletic events will be brought back to their parent/guardian/caregiver. Thank you for helping us do what we can to keep our events enjoyable for all fans and focused on the athletic endeavors of our players.

SCHOLASTIC BOOK FAIR 10/16-10/20
The fall book fair is coming soon. Support our school and help your child discover new books by shopping at our Book Fair. The Fair will be offered starting Monday October 16th until Friday the 20th. It will be open during the school day and closed during the lunch hour. You can still shop virtually and have books shipped to your house by visiting our website below. If you are sending money with your child to buy books please put in an envelope with the amount written on the outside. This helps our volunteers to assist your child with buying books.
When visiting our website please consider setting up an eWallet account. Setting up an eWallet allows you to add money to your account online. When students shop at the Book Fair, they won't need to bring in money, we will look up their e-Wallet account to pay for books. Any unused money can be used to buy books at the Scholastic Store online. If you have questions please reach out to Tabitha Schultz or Becky Wasikowski at bookfairpv@gmail.com.
